Dr. Soundar Kumara is a Professor of Industrial and Manufacturing Engineering
at Penn State. He also holds a joint appointment with the Computer Science and
Engineering department. Dr. Kumara obtained his BS degree in Mechanical Engineering
from Sri Venkateswara University, Tirupati, India; M/Tech in Industrial Engineering
from Indian Institute of Technology, Madras, India; and Ph.D., from Purdue University,
USA. He held CSK Chair Visiting Associate Professor position at the Research Center
for Advanced Science and Technology, University of Tokyo, Japan and Visiting Associate
Professor, Mechanical Engineering, Massachusetts Institute of Technology, Cambridge,
MA, USA. His research interests are in Multiagent systems in Logistics and Manufacturing,
Sensor based process monitoring and Chaos theory based process modeling. Dr. Kumara
is an active member of CIRP.
